Nora Babcock has been practicing law in Allegheny and surrounding counties for over twenty years. Her private practice is located in the North Hills and focuses on elder law, wills and estates and in the general legal areas encompassing litigation, insurance issues, personal injury, real estate and small business matters.

As a graduate of the University of Pittsburgh School of Law in 1985, Nora began her career in civil defense law. She represented clients in insurance claims involving personal injury, property damage, toxic tort, workers compensation and first party insurance issues. In 1991 she became staff counsel for one of the nation’s largest commercial insurance carriers and for the next 10 years litigated cases on a wide range of issues including auto and trucking, fire loss, premises liability, underinsured motorist, defamation, industrial accidents, product liability, construction and boundary disputes. She has appeared before the Common Pleas courts in numerous counties in Pennsylvania and also before the Superior Court of Pennsylvania and the Federal District Court for the Western District of Pennsylvania. In 2000 she was engaged as a claims attorney for a specialty insurance company insuring architects and engineers where she managed litigation on large construction claims throughout the Eastern United States. She has significant jury trial, non-jury trial, alternative dispute and mediation experience.

Currently, in her private practice, Nora relies on her solid legal experience to advocate for individuals, families and small businesses. She is particularly concerned for individuals and families who are planning for or confronted with the issues related to aging, illness and end of life.
